About This Book

What if you asked your parents for a new brother or sister but found a puppy instead? Amelia Bedelia’s wish sends her on a silly adventure full of laughs and surprises. Will she find the perfect furry friend before her family’s plans change everything?

Quick Assessment

Amelia Bedelia Unleashed is a humorous middle-grade book about a girl who wishes for a sibling but gets caught up in the excitement of finding a puppy. It’s a lighthearted story appropriate for ages 9-12, featuring playful misunderstandings and family dynamics. Parents can expect gentle humor without any intense themes.
